The chimney flue is the inner shaft that vents smoke as well as gases which are produced by burning a fire in the fire place. Damage to the flue, fractures in between the bricks, and deteriorating mortar occur after years of use. In cases of light to modest damages, it's feasible to take care of the loose mortar and cracks. Adding a chimney liner or relining your chimney can help safeguard your flue from damage as well as prevent fires. The three major types of liners are metal, clay, and cast-in-place liners.
Metal liners are a newly favored type of chimney liner for upgrades and repair services. They are usually produced from stainless steel, although they can in some cases be made from light weight aluminum as well. Metal liners are are really versatile, readily available in stiff or flexible versions, and most any type of house can accommodate them.
Clay tile liners are some of the most common type of chimney liner. Most older houses have clay liners. They are rather economical, yet need routine upkeep to make certain that flue tiles do not crack, split, or break.
Cast in place liners are a light material comparable to cement that is installed inside the chimney for a seamless flue. These sorts of liners tend to be hard to. install as well as pricey. Gradually, they can start to develop cracks and require relining.

The chimney crown is very crucial. It functions as a protective concrete umbrella or rooftop for your entire chimney. This shields your flue as well as chimney from rain and other elements.
When the chimney crown establishes cracks or becomes damaged at all, it allows rain water seep through the chimney and expand and contract. This can trigger extreme damages to the entire chimney if not fixed. When found early, basic repair work can be made to avoid issues from occurring.
If cracking in the chimney crown is minor, the splits can be loaded with patch and a waterproof sealer can be used on top. This will safely keep water from entering.
In situations where there is a lot more substantial damage to the crown, it might be needed to rebuild it. If the chimney is still in good condition, then it's possible to rebuild just the crown. This will secure the chimney for a lot more years. It is necessary to have a professional chimney repair examine the crown, flue, and entire chimney to ensure all areas are safe.
A chimney cap protects your home in many ways. It keeps rain, snow, and, dirt and animals out of your fireplace and also protects against hot sparks as well as embers from flying out and into your roofing. You ought to never run your fire place or wood burning stove without a chimney cap.

Many people confuse the chimney damper with the flue. The flue is the inside of the chimney that smoke travels through. The damper is the portion of the chimney that closes off air flow to the outside. When a damper comes to be old, it requires repair work. Usually repairing or replacing the existing old metal damper can be expensive.
It's better to set up a top sealing damper. They are less expensive, and every efficient. A top sealing damper will keep cold drafts as well as undesirable weather outside. A substantial amount of air movement can leak in through the chimney from the exterior, making your residence feel colder in the winter. This can quickly add up to hundreds of dollars annually in extra home heating expenses.

The firebox is the place inside the fireplace where the fire burns. This portion of of the fire place can sometimes need repair services. Firebox tuckpointing is a process that eliminates old mortar joints. The surface between the joints is cleaned, and then the old joints are loaded with brand-new cement. Cracked or loosened bricks can likewise be fixed.
Prefabricated fire places have refractory panels. These panels are fixed by cutting and sizing replacement panels, fitting them together and installing them.
